Scope: nightly rebalancing planner for the Caldwick bike-share fleet. Verify: (a) station capacity table refreshed within 24h; (b) truck-route solver timeout set to 90s, no silent fallbacks; (c) demand-forecast model version pinned and logged per run; (d) manual override actions recorded with timestamps. Finding: override audit log gaps on two dates, now backfilled. Remediation: log write moved ahead of plan commit. Re-check next quarter. Accountability for this control rests with the individual identified below.

approver of kadug-fajop = Zorael Ulaox Kasvan Casir

**Alert: CAL-SYNC-CONFLICT (Meridian Scheduler)**

This alert fires when a plugin writes an event revision that conflicts with a newer upstream revision already committed by the Tidewell sync engine. The conflicting write is quarantined, not dropped; your plugin will receive a `conflict` webhook with both revisions attached. Plugins must resolve by resubmitting against the latest revision token — never by force-overwriting. Resolution flow, payload schemas, and retry limits are documented on the internal page below.

wiki page, tahaf-tajog: https://jira.ordindyn.corp/pipeline

## Parcel Webhook Setup

Traceporter fires a webhook on every parcel status change. Point `WEBHOOK_URL` at your local tunnel, set `WEBHOOK_RETRIES=3`, and keep payload validation on. Don't skip validation in staging — we've been burned. The webhook also requires a signing secret so we can verify payloads; add it on the following line.

sealed setting: ARCHIVE_KEY3=8d0